The Opportunity

We are seeking a Virtual Executive Assistant to provide high-level support to the Managing

Partner. This is a hands-on, strategic role that goes beyond traditional admin tasks, ideal for someone who is deeply organized, tech-savvy, and able to anticipate needs before they

arise.

You will work directly with the Managing Partner in a fast-paced environment, playing a key role in streamlining communications, managing workflows, maintaining calendars, and

supporting both personal and business priorities. The right candidate will not only keep

things running smoothly day-to-day, but will also contribute ideas and systems to improve

efficiency and long-term structure.

This is a new and important role within our U.S. office. It requires someone who thrives in a

high-responsibility environment, is comfortable handling sensitive information, and brings a calm, grounded presence to a demanding schedule.

The company is on an ambitious growth path in the U.S., and this is a unique opportunity for someone who wants to get in early, work directly with leadership, and grow alongside the firm.

Key Responsibilities

Daily and Weekly Support

● Be available during core working hours and start one hour before the Partner’s day

● Prepare email and task reviews in advance of the day

● Manage busy and variable daily schedules with a high level of coordination and

planning

● Maintain and update weekly planning and recurring tasks ahead of time (ideally

Sundays or early Mondays)

Administrative and Operational Tasks

● Manage email inboxes, prioritize and flag items for review, and draft responses

where needed

● Handle incoming and outgoing calls on behalf of the Managing Partner (e.g.,

vendors, payment follow-ups, scheduling)

● Coordinate and manage calendars, meeting invites, reminders, and time blocking

● Track and complete recurring weekly and monthly tasks across personal and

business domains
